what is needed to get a q45 diff in an s14?
I dont think Q45s are R200 diffs.
I read somewhere that they won't fit due to the length of the diff and gearing will slow down crusing speeds more than a J30 diff will.

Most Q45's if not ALL have an R230 not an R200 so they have a 230mm ring gear and are considerably larger overall than an R200. The bolts on the back have a different spacing and the diff snout length is different as far as I know.
Basically it won't fit.
Any reason for wanting one? The stock R200 can handle sick power and is much lighter than an R230. You can get gears anywhere from I think 3.6 to like 4.88 too.
